Australian Junior Selection Regatta

Sydney University Boat Club for the first time ever will be sending four athletes and a Cox to the National Junior Selection Regatta, to be held from the 7th May to 9th May at Sydney International Regatta Centre. The crew has only just been finalised today (5/4/03), after ergo trials and seat racing at Penrith. During the past week seven athletes from various GPS school trialed for the seats in the SUBC Junior four, which aim to be selected next month as the Australian Junior Four. Angus Campbell (as pictured) from St Ignatius College won the 2000m ergo trial in a time of 6.13, closely followed by St Ignatius Old Boy, Rupert Sheridan. Today the guy?s seat raced in a coxed four, racing over a distance of 1500m, to finalise the crew and seating within the crew.

After seven races the crew was finalised as following: Harry Horwitz-Rouke (TKS), Angus Campbell (SIC), Rupert Sheridan (SUBC), Alex Cary (TKS), Bert Williams (TKS) as the Cox and Marty Rabjohns coaching. The crew commences training at Linley Point on Monday morning and with only four weeks remaining until selection; the guys will be working hard towards perfection!

Within the club the crew has two excellent role models in Matt Ryan and Ian Allsop, who both represented Australian in the Junior Coxed Four last year, the crew winning a Gold Medal at the World Junior Championships. With this result fresh in the crews mind, they will be aiming to replicate a similar result.
